General Meeting - 21 June 2016 June Club Night again made Northern Group members‟ appreciate the abundance of knowledge and excellent speaking skills within APST membership. Mick and Helen Statham visited the USA last year timing their trip to be there for the Fall season. They were surprised at the bumper to bumper traffic jams, four and a half kilometre road blocks on the way to White Mountain National Forest, New Hampshire and amused at the nightly news “leaf report” on TV. Mick not only showed us colourful photos of maples and other deciduous plants but explained the biochemistry involved. Temperate deciduous plants occur in areas where there is a big temperature range. They tend to have large leaves and thin sap which aids photosynthesis and supply of nutrients in the short growing season. The disadvantage is that big leaves collect snow and ice and thin sap can freeze, so they drop their leaves. As it gets colder, a layer of cells develop which produce cork cells (the abscission layer) resulting in a weak point in the petiole (stem) and the leaves, like many fruit, fall off. Related to this, Mick also explained why the leaves change colour so spectacularly which we also see in the Tasmanian Nothafagus gunnii, the endemic Tasmanian deciduous tree.

Why Leaves are seen as Green, Yellow, Orange and Red. In the warmer months chlorophyll, a and b absorb much of the light energy that falls on the leaves and use this energy to produce sugars (and starches and cellulose) from carbon dioxide and water absorbed from the atmosphere. Chlorophyll a and b absorb and make use of red light and blue-violet light but not green light. The green light is reflected and hence leaves look green. As the sunlight hours diminish and the weather cools, the level of chlorophyll in leaves drops allowing other colourful compounds to become visible. Carotenes (orange pigments) and xanthophylls ( yellow pigments) are more stable than chlorophyll and persist in the leaf giving it its orange or yellow colour. These two chemicals are also involved in photosynthesis. As the leaves age further all the pigments are used and in many species the brown of tannin is left. Tannins act as a defence mechanism against pathogens, herbivores and hostile environmental conditions protecting the trees over the winter as they occur in almost all parts of the plants.

Julie Nermut spoke about plants she greatly

admires–Eremophilas.

In the Family Scrophulariaceae, Tribe Myoporeae,

Eremophilas are endemic to Australia. The first

plants were collected in the Spencer Gulf by

Robert Brown, the botanist with Matthew Flinders‟

ship “Investigator” in1802. Since then, over 260 species have been discovered

with 43 species and 24 subspecies in the last 20 years. There are also several

hundred hybrids and cultivars. They are located widespread across Australia in

arid areas.

A fascinating fact was that some Eremophilas are pollinated by birds and others

by insects. Colour and shape make the difference with brighter colours attracting

birds and the purples, blues and mauves the insects. Stigma. style, anther and

filament also protrude in the plants attracting birds.

Eremophilas

Julie illustrated how the same Eremophila species, latrobii can vary with the red soils of the Victoria Desert SA producing green leaves while the grey soils of Tibooburra NSW having very blue-green leaves. Others only grow in specific areas, like E.christophorii in the Macdonald Ranges and E. freelinssii in the Trephina Gorge NT.

Others vary from small trees such as E.gelesii ( pictured above, left) near Windorah whose wind/insect pollinated large flowers are a brilliant mauve to Eremophila gibsonii, ( photo left) at Mt Augustus, a large shrub with white or mauve flowers.

Julie also found E.cuneifolia, E reticulata and E. maculata ( all pictured below left to right) on a station at Mt Augustus south of Mt Magnet WA in natural bushland.

Propagation is difficult and Julie has tried many techniques including smoked water, fire, temperature variation, stratification

and growth hormone. Cuttings and grafting with Myoporum stock works well. However, Eremophilas are well worth growing as

they have low water usage, grow in a range of soils, are variable in size and foliage colour, grow in shade or full sun, attract

birds and insects and have very showy red, pink, blue, purple, white and yellow flowers. Some tolerate light frost but grey

forms can get fungus and all get root rot if too much water. Plant in spring, mulch and prune after flowering for good results.

June Plant of the Month Rosemary Verbeeten chose Backhousia citriadora as June

Plant of the Month.

Backhousia is an endemic genus of 13 currently known species of

flowering plants in the family of Myrtaceae. Rosemary listed the

species which are from Queensland and NSW including

B.citriadora while Backhousia gundarara is from the Kimberley's,

WA. The genus was named after James Backhouse an English

naturalist, nurseryman, Quaker missionary and artist who travelled

through colonial Australian from 1832 to 1838. Species in

Blandfordia, Correa , Octoclinus, Helichrysum and Wilsonia are

also named after him.

Backhousia citriadora is a medium shrub to tree growing from about 3 metres up to 20 metres in height in its natural

habitat and has a low branching habit. Leaves elliptical or lanceolate in shape and glossy dark green with slightly

toothed margins and are strongly lemon scented. The very attractive flowers are creamy white in umbrel-like clusters

near the ends of branches. It flowers over Summer and Autumn and the flowers are attractive to bees and nectar eating

birds and butterflies. A beautiful ornamental which only grows to a medium sized shrub in Tasmania and the lemon

scented leaves can be used for culinary purposes. ( Photo by R. Verbeeten).

July General Meeting saw two stalwart members of Northern Group, Rosemary Verbeeten and Margaret Killen, give presentations. Rosemary was our main speaker giving us an entertaining and amusing speech titled, “My Garden and Lessons Learnt”. Since moving to Lanena in the Tamar Valley from West Gippsland 22 years ago, Rosemary, along with husband, Alf, has transformed a one hectare sheep paddock containing not only sheep but cracked willow, blackberries, boneseed and pampas, into a superb natural-style Australian native garden. The “before” land (left) with sheep and remnant orchard and below right, the developed front garden.

First, Rosemary and Alf transformed a very ordinary house into an elegant, colonial-style home which takes advantage of views of the Tamar Estuary. In preparing the garden, they soon found the soil was grey loam over hard packed clay which gets waterlogged in winter and hydrophobic in summer. Although Rosemary says the garden has not been formally planned, anyone visiting today finds this hard to believe finding winding paths and vistas taking advantage of the natural habitat, water features, bridges, sculptures, herb, vegetable and fruit gardens, not to mention the multitude of colourful and diverse native plants and a great chook house!

The frog pond (above) is now a central feature of the garden, but it began as a hole lined with a purple carpet from the house they bought which Rosemary was pleased ‗to drown‘. A roof downpipe feeds the pond which only needs the occasional top up in a dry year. Along with ephemeral ponds to make use of soak areas, these water features harbour native hens, brown tree frogs, smooth frogs and the common frogs as well as many bird species.

Wide grassed swathes were kept for vehicular access and native grazing by possums, pademelons, bandicoots and wombats. With the garden maturing, there is abundant bird life with 30 different species observed over a 12 month period. Rosemary now propagates most her own plants with an increased emphasis on the indigenous plants of Tasmania. Some of her favourite plants are Banksias, Callistemons, Orthrosanthus multiflorus, Correas, Eremophilas, Clematis clitrioides, Poa, Lomandra, Dianella and Lepidsperma,Asterotrichion discolour, alogyone huegelii, Eryngium ovinum, Dietes robin-sonana, Elaeocarpus reticulatus and Gastrodia sesamoides. ―Now onto lessons learnt‖ says Rosemary: Make sure your fencing is secure and animal proof –worth every dollar spent; develop one section at a time but keep in mind an overall plan; do not plant too many grevilleas or wattle birds will dominate to the detriment of smaller species and honeyeaters and other birds need seeds to eat as well; grasses are important too for seeds, nesting material and ground cover for small fauna and lizards; diversity is important including climbers; rocks and logs as edging are a great habitat for beetles, worms and insects; plant in late autumn with tube stock; ―groom‖ continuously by carrying secateurs as you walk around – prune, prune, prune and start early in a plant‘s life and you will be rewarded with denser, healthier shrubs. Time becomes a dimension of a garden as plants develop, light and moisture levels change. The garden is always evolving. Rosemary hoped she inspired us and she certainly did!

July Plant of the Month presented by Margaret Killen

Xanthorrhoea Grass trees and are an ancient, unique and iconic feature of the Australian landscape and eight years ago she was lucky enough to be given one for her birthday. It is now flourishing and this year producing a flower spike. The 28 species are distributed around Australia with four of these in Tasmania: Xanthorrhoea arearia, Xanthorrhoea australis, Xanthorrhoea minor and Xanthorrhoea nana. They are slow growing with a growth rate 10-20mm per year and those species which develop trunks take about 20 years to do so. They are also long lived with some known to be about 600 years old. Xanthorrhoea‘s are related to lilies and share many attributes with Lomandras (saggs) to which they are closely related. Their structure has a trunk, if included, a grass skirt and flower spike. Xanthorrhoea macronema is an example of a species which does not have a trunk. The flower spikes are long and cylindrical rising one to three meters above the skirt, the white to yellow flowers (florets) develop along the stem and turn into black seeds, at each stage providing food for birds and insects. Cultivation is considered difficult with seeds taking up to a year to germinate and then a slow growth rate. The Aboriginals had many uses for this plant as tools and especially for food, using the tender white section of the leaf bases and succu-lent roots. Seeds were ground into flour for dough to make damper. Edible grubs lived in the base and honey extracted from bees‘ nests which were bored into the soft pith of the flower spike. A sweet or, with some days of fermentation, slightly alcoholic drink was obtained by washing the nectar from the flower spike. Early settlers also made use of the plant notably using the resin as a replacement for incense in churches or as an ingredient of varnish for floors and furniture and a polish for metals and other uses. Conservation of Xanthorrhoea has become a concerning issue as their communities are continually reduced by land clearing, urban and rural development and the spread of the fungal disease, Phytophthora.

Lynne Mockridge gave the Plant of the Month talk with Mentha australis, the native mint. This is widespread throughout Australia near creeks and rivers but only known in Tasmania from small subpopulations in riparian habitats of the South Esk and Rubicon Rivers in the north. It is one of two native mints in Tasmania the other being Mentha diemenica. They are in the Lamiaceae family and are both herbs with small flowers. M.australis is a soft, sprawling, sometimes erect, strongly aromatic perennial herb. Recruitment is by suckering or from seed. The four-lobed white flowers are in clusters in the upper

leaf axils so that the branches are visible between. The leaves are quite narrow (three times long as wide), about 2 to 5 cm long with pointed teeth. It is listed as endangered. However, M.australis grows well in the home garden and is excellent for culinary purposes. Next, Jill showed us photos of the wide range of birds which visit her garden and the plants which most attract them. Some of Jill‟s visitors include the crescent honeyeater, eastern spinebill, Tasmanian thornbill along with black faced cuckoo shrikes and butcher birds. The yellow tail cockatoos shred her Banksia marginata and Banksia „Birthday Candles‟ while the honeyeaters love Jill‟s Callistemon „Little John‟, Anigozanthos sp., Grevillea juniperina and Hymenosporum flavum.

A prostrate form of Brachysema attracts small birds which worries Jill because of neighbourhood cats. Four cheeky magpies regularly land on the balcony, and Jill‟s bird baths are popular with the smaller birds.

Roy and Louise grew Ceratopetalum gummiferum, the NSW

Christmas bush covered with red sepals in December when

they lived in NSW but now enjoy its colour in late summer

and all through autumn in coastal Tasmania.

C.gummiferum is one of nine Ceratopetalum which grow in

Australia and New Guinea. C.gummiferum is native to

Sydney and north NSW coastal regions where it is a loved

wildflower used in the cut flower industry. Although it can be

kept trimmed to a bush, it matures to a small pyramidical,

evergreen tree, 6 x 3 m. Leaves comprise three leaflets and

new growth is bright yellow green or reddish.

Clusters of small creamy-white five-petaled flowers appear

from December but as they die, the sepals/calyxes greatly

enlarge and become pink or red in colour. (This can be

seen in the photo on the right).

C.gummiferum is one of those group of plants which have only small flowers but enlarge their sepals for a

great show of colour. Others are Bourgainvilleas, Hydrangeas and Poinsettias. C. gummiferum grows on the

Tasmanian east coast and can withstand moderate frosts. It requires moist but well drained soil to avoid

dieback from root rot fungus. For propagation, sow whole seed with calyx attached or cuttings. It is a mass

of pink sepals in late summer and a great ornamental small tree for a warm spot in a garden.

Peter loves native trees and spoke about Phyllocladus

aspleniifolius, the celery top pine. Although not a true pine,

Phyllocladus does belong to the classification Gymnosperms

meaning ‗naked seed‘ as there is no ovary or fruit protecting it

but it is surrounded by modified leaves known as a cone giv-

ing rise to the sub-classification of coniferaea. The generic

name Phyllocladus refers to the fact that photosynthesis is

performed in ‗ leaf branches‘ called cladodes.

There are many other plants that have non-dedicated leaves.

All but three of the Tasmanian Acacias develop phyllodes on adult plants

and these perform photosynthesis. Some cacti have cladodes including

the dreaded prickly pear. The specific name aspleniifolius refers to its

superficial resemblance to some species of the ferns in the genus

Asplenium. The mature trees are 6-18 m high, monoecious or dioecious.

The leaves of seedlings are linear, acuminate,1 cm long, while on the

adult plant, leaves are reduced to small deciduous scales. Celery top pine

is widespread in temperate and wet sclerophyll forests from sea level to

2500feet. ( Photos Steve Allwood)

CLUB NIGHT Roy commenced by showing us a photo and asking, “What is this”? No one knew this WEIRD ONE! He explained how he espied it on several islands in the Whitsundays growing at the base of some rain-forest trees. Having no idea himself, photos were sent for ID to Brisbane Botanical Gardens. Promptly, they replied, identifying the species as Balanophora fungosa, a parasitic genus which is restricted to Queensland tropics and sub-tropics, sea level to 900m. It is also found in Asia and some Pacific islands. The genus was first described in 1775 by Johann Reinhold Forster and his son George Forster. Like other members of its genus, B. fungosa is holoparasitic and contains no chlorophyll. The aerial parts of the plant consist of a hard, irregularly shaped tuber from which the flower-bearing structures extend. The leaves are scale-like, pale cream in colour, 8–30 millimetres long, 7–20 millimetres wide and more or less stem clasping.

The plant is monoecious, bearing both female and male flowers. Thousands of minute female flowers cover a globe-shaped structure about the size of a golfball. About 20 male flowers are arranged around the base of the globe, each about 3–5 millimetres in diameter and are cov-ered with powdery white pollen.

The male flower is above left , highly magnified and the female flower, also highly magnified, is pictured right. Twelve species of plant in eight families are known to be hosts to Balanophora fungosa including some of those in the genera Syzygium, Olea and Rapanea. The plant is sometimes a weed in coffee and tea plantations. Numerous small animals visit the flowers, including ants, springtails, flies, bees, moths and even rats.

Relocation of Northern Group Nursery by Roy Skabo Janet Hallam and Julie Nermut are to be congratulated on their successful negotiations with the West Tamar Council which resulted in an offer by the WTC to accommodate our nursery at Windsor Park adjacent to the Community Garden. The WTC will provide a securely fenced, gravel-surfaced area for our shade house and outdoor benches and will provide connections for water and power. An old building known as the Stables will provide us with an under-cover propagation area where we can locate our benches and store our propagation materials and tools. We will pay the Council a moderate annual rent for the use of this excellent facility. Our group has also been successful in securing a $5000 grant from NRM North to assist with the relocation. We have had four galvanized steel hardening-off benches constructed and these have already arrived on site. These benches are wide enough to accommodate two trays placed end to end and thus we will have the equivalent of 32m of bench space for our stock of plants. WTC requires us to employ a registered builder to re-erect the shade-house after our members have dismantled it and moved it to the site. A builder has been organised to do the work in late October. We will also need to construct a more elaborate watering system than we now have at Grassy Banks. The plan is to provide separate circuits for misting of cuttings, sprinkling of the inside plants and automatic watering for the outdoor stock. We will also need to erect storage bins for the potting mixes and their ingredients. A group of members has already volunteered to do the work of moving the shade-house and the plants and to establish the watering system. Roy Pallett has agreed to coordinate the work from here on after Roy Skabo did the initial organising. Any member interested in helping with the relocation should contact Roy Pallett. If all goes well our nursery will be in its new home soon after our October sale. It has been a real team effort which started with Jill Clark suggesting the site.
